Costume Shop Manager

Under the general direction of the Production Manager, the incumbent will manage the costume shop for a fast-paced multi-venue/ multi-performance environment. The incumbent will oversee the completion of all graduates designed, pulled, rented and jobbed out costumes (including wigs, millinery, armor, accessories and other required elements for the costume/character) for all School of the Arts productions. They will supervise and manage costume shop staff including but not limited to: cutters, first hands, stitchers, makeup artists, and crafts persons. They will oversee all costume fittings. They will be responsible for all fiscal related materials for the costume area including budgets, cash advance reconciliation, travel reimbursement, payroll tracking and costume inventory control system. They will also need to supervise and train Drama 101 students while they are in the costume area.
 
Responsible for supervision and training of staff and students associated with a specific technical aspect of theater productions. May include responsibility for maintenance of theater venues, shops, and storage facilities, including facilities and stage equipment, tools and materials, and developing and implementing operational procedures for all users within the facilities.
